Event significance and trophy inheritance
The 26th Gulf Cup was held in Kuwait City from December 21, 2024 to January 3, 2025. In the end, Bahrain defeated Oman 2-1 and won the sixth championship title. As the most prestigious football event in the Arab world, the Gulf Cup trophy symbolizes sports glory and cultural cohesion. Design Innovation
Cultural Fusion
The smooth outline of the trophy is inspired by the smooth lines of the traditional Arab headdress (Ghitra), and the top is decorated with a golden football symbolizing unity. The base is inscribed with the intricate Arabic calligraphy of “Mawtani” (my motherland), a nod to the cultural heritage of the Gulf region and a celebration of cross-cultural harmony.
Sustainable material innovation
The trophy is made of 95% recycled metal and plated with 18K gold, and its environmentally friendly design meets the sustainable development standards of major global sporting events.
Modular inheritance system
The innovative removable design allows the winning team to keep the golden football module, while the base becomes a permanent exhibit in the Gulf Cup Museum, creating a timeless historical narrative for future events.
Exquisite technology and exquisite craftsmanship
A team of 30 craftsmen took four months to create the trophy:
Precision casting: Digital modeling and mold casting processes achieve seamless accuracy of 0.5 毫米.
Advanced coating: Nano-level electroplating technology improves the trophy’s anti-oxidation performance by 60% in desert climate conditions.
